About SNAP Employment & Training Services

Easterseals-Goodwill administers employment and training services for SNAP recipients in 10 Montana counties. We’re here to help anyone who receives or is eligible for SNAP access no-cost education and training resources and one-on-one support so they can reach their employment goals.

We’ll not only help you enroll in paid job training programs like the ones mentioned above, we’ll also help you during and after training with more no-cost services to boost your job-finding and job-keeping success:

One-on-one Career Coaching
Soft Skills Classes
Job Placement Assistance
Workshops (interviewing, resume writing, job searches & applications)
On-the-job Coaching
Community Partner Resource Referrals (to help overcome any work barriers you may face)
Help with Job-related Expenses & Transportation Costs

Our Service Area

Easterseals-Goodwill provides the service in Cascade County and works with partner agencies in Big Horn, Deer Lodge, Flathead, Gallatin, Lewis & Clark, Lincoln, Missoula, Silver Bow, and Yellowstone counties to provide SNAP Employment & Training Services.
